However, in order to do so, the games need to be as fun and energized as the early Spongebob cartoons. That being said, this game fails not because of technical hiccups or bugs, but solely due to a lack of originality that could have been exploited from such a rich subject material. The game spans several different themed worlds that each possess three mini-games. The player who earns the most points at the end of this competition wins the coveted role of the super-villain in the new Mermaid Man and Barnacle Boy show. The concept is great and allows for a variety of famous locales to be explored. The first four regions are where the game shines, as it features frantic fun flipping Krabby Patties and fighting off Plankton's creations and jamming out to a rock solo with Spongebob's electric guitar. These games work because they are fast-paced and exciting to play with friends. After this point, however, the game falls fast and the creativity soon dies out. Repetitive and simplistic games ruin the rest of the experience, either being too easy to win (one game involving soccer I won 38-0 because of the laughably bad opponent AI) or too frustrating to enjoy, such as a barnacle scraping game that involves spamming the square button until your fingers fall off. Overall, I really enjoy the concept of Lights, Camera, Pants. Done right, this idea could have the potential to challenge any other party game on the market with unique Spongebob themed challenges. However, until the games can be consistently fun and addictive as their source material, Lights, Camera, Pants will remain in the shadows.

    I love everything about the game. The graphics, music, sound and gameplay is superb. I love the story in which you take part in a competition to become the super-villain for the new Mermaidman and BarnacleBoy movie. There are multiple locations from the show you play three mini games in in order to progress onto the next. There are a total of 64 mini games in which you play and can unlock for single player and multiplayer. I like when you complete story mode on easy, normal and hard, you unlock a bonus mini game. You can play as the beloved characters from the show. It gets more fun when you play 4 player. There are many game modes that will keep you and your friends entertained.

    There are many unlockables to earn such as pictures and trophies but there are more hidden unlockables to earn if you have multiple save files of other Nickelodeon games for more replayability.

    Overall its a childhood classic.

    The only minor complaints I have with the game are the annoying voice acting and slightly repetitive gameplay.

However, the problem is that, unlike a game like Mario Party, the mini-games here offer little replayability, as there are very little elements to the games that allow for more than a few playthroughs to feel rewarding. Also, mainly for this reason, the single-player mode also feels very shallow, and after a few tries, not challenging in the least. It is unfortunate, because it is a decent game, but it could have been so much better. Expand
